BTTS: No & under 2.5 goals in Tunisia v Angola (18:00)
The African Cup of Nations has not been a high-scoring tournament so far.
Guinea’s 2-2 draw with Madagascar is the only game out of seven where BTTS has landed and there has been over 2.5 goals.
Both teams have scored in just two of Angola’s last eight matches, while just two of Tunisia’s last six games have seen both teams bag.
BTTS in France U21 v Romania U21 (20:00)
Romania followed their 4-1 victory over Croatia in their opening match with a 4-2 win against England on Friday.
That was their third match in four where BTTS has landed, while they have scored three or more in four of their last five.
France have only failed to score once in their last 29 matches, so they should also do their bit.
Under 2.5 goals in Sweden Women v Canada Women (20:00)
Sweden come into their last-16 match on the back of a 2-0 defeat to the USA, and there have been three or more goals in just two of their last seven matches.
Their only World Cup match to tip the balance was a 5-1 victory over Thailand in their second group game.
Canada lost 2-1 to the Netherlands in their last group game, but that was only their third game in 12 to have had three or more goals.
Mali to beat Mauritania (21:00)
Mauritania lost 3-1 to Benin in their final warm-up friendly last week and have lost eight of their last 13 matches.
They have only beaten Madagascar, Botswana, Angola, Burkina Faso and Guinea in that sequence, so they are unlikely to cause a shock here.
Mali have lost just two of their last 12 matches, against Algeria and Senegal.
